In a statement, United chief executive Ben Mansford said the club were “disappointed” with the length of the ban. “After careful consideration and consultation with the club, Liam pleaded guilty to the charges brought against him as he acknowledges that the coming together with Reece Oxford was reckless,” Mansford said. “However, in my experience Liam is an honest and genuine person who would never intend to hurt another player. “Liam is a leader and his influence in the dressing room will still play a major role in the remaining fixtures this season.” Speaking last night before the length of Cooper’s punishment was known, Monk voiced sympathy for him but admitted the defender was right to plead guilty. Cooper caught Oxford in the face with his boot during the second half at the Madejski Stadium and was cited by the FA ahead of yesterday’s trip to Griffin Park. Monk insisted that Cooper had not shown “intent” but United’s head coach conceded that the clash had been “reckless”. “We spoke to Liam and as a club we supported him,” Monk said. “We pleaded guilty to a reckless charge but 100 per cent we didn’t plead guilty to an intent charge. “We know Liam very well and as a person he’s not like that. One hundred per cent we didn’t plead guilty to an intent charge.

WAZZOCK Why the oxf*rd do Leeds sing 'Champions of Europe'?

Never won the European Cup and haven't won a European trophy in 40 years.


I think it is reference to the 1975 European Cup (Champions League) Final versus Bayern Munich in which Leeds dominated but following some genuinely diabolical refereeing, were finally beaten 2-0.
With the score at 0-0 and Leeds rampaging, two quite clear cut penalties were waved away before peter Lorimer smashed one in to seemingly put Leeds one up. The Referee pointed to the centre circle and the Linesman ran to take up his position for the restart. However, Bayern Munich were EUFAS favourite team at the time and with some players protesting Man Utd style, they convinced the Ref to wrongly change his mind. This broke Leeds and Bayern Munich scored two late ones to piss on the Leeds fireworks.
Leeds fans understandly went mental, ripped the stadium apart, bombarded the officials with seats, smashed up large parts of Paris and received a lengthy ban.
What was suprising is that as a result, Eufa considered doing away with the competition all together.

Although what Leeds fans tend to omit is that two Bayern defenders suffered career ending injuries in the first half after fouls by Terry Yorath and Frank Gray

Of the 2 penalties, yeah, one was a foul on Alan Clarke, the other, the ball struck Beckenbauer's arm as he was lying on the ground. The disallowed goal? Bremner was offside but arguably not interfering with play even though he was inside the 6yd box.

The old Cloughism, "If you're not interfering with play, what the bloody hell are you doing on the pitch." Leeds fans contend he was pushed into an offside position by an unscrupulous German defender.

In fairness to Leeds, both the referee and the linesman gave the goal until Beckenbauer bent their ears.

Maybe there was some unfairness going on but the game kicked off with a career ending foul by Yorath in the 2nd minute and that's the crux with the Revie side, it was a phenomenally talented team that could have won titles playing fairly but it chose to play dirty.
